Welcome to the AddrSnap widget! It powers address autocomplete across all Plover Systems checkout pages. The typeahead hits our Geofetch index, debounced at 150ms — don't lower that, Marisol tried and the index cried. Deploys go through the Tilbury pipeline; config lives in the maintainers' vault. If you ever need to rotate the Geofetch credentials, unlock the vault with the recovery passphrase below.

unlock words, yagep-fahof: belix-rusvan-casdor-gorox-aldath-norael-istix-quenael-fraeth-silael

## Runbook: Upstream Circuit Breaker (Fernwald Rates API)

When the Fernwald Rates API starts timing out, our circuit breaker in the Quillgate service trips after five consecutive failures and holds open for ninety seconds. New team members: never disable the breaker in production; instead, adjust thresholds in staging first and watch the half-open probes recover. The breaker reads its admin credentials from the service's env file at boot. Add the following line to that file before restarting Quillgate.

sealed setting: RELAY_SECRET5=82864

The Mosstile cache layer fronts the Verdapane tile renderer and serves pre-rasterized tiles keyed by zoom, extent, and style hash. Cache writes are idempotent; evictions follow LRU with a 72-hour ceiling. Reviewers should confirm that any new endpoint sets the style hash header, since omitting it bypasses the cache entirely and hammers the renderer. All requests to the cache admin surface require a service credential passed in the auth header. For local verification against the staging cache, authenticate with the key that follows.

gateway credential: kto3_qfe